Back to victory for Crespi

alps-tour

Italian Marco Crespi, 34 year old, got back to success on Alps Tour. He won Le Fonti Open after last score 67 to aggregate -12. The player from Monza had to wait until last hole of France’s Clément Gallois to catch 4th trophy. Frenchman, unfortunatly for him, dropped one shot on the last hole and miss his first opportunity to go into a play off.

Crespi is used to win and only failed last year to get a victory. As he said, he needed two in 2011, one is done. Gallois had his second podium in Italy this year after a third place in Milano 3 weeks ago.
Third man on the podium is Italian Marco Bernadini with -10.

Marco Crespi thanks to this win jumped to 4th place at the Alps Tour ranking.
